Output 134ce7640069e13268f3ad83030457d4e51304ae3624f9cc5b4d5e03766bf636:14

value
640782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e0a22ae4190dac426ef0cbd0f8249c324f920f OP_EQUAL
address
3NTvQtvxbaPFPCdAZQEukJXzt8zKsbRRd1
transaction
134ce7640069e13268f3ad83030457d4e51304ae3624f9cc5b4d5e03766bf636
spent
true